Donated
services
are
included
in
the Statement of Futancial Activity, where the benefit to the charity is
reasonably
quantifiable,
measurable and material, as incoming resources mtd resources
expended.
They are
valued at the amount that the Charity would have to pay to acquire them at the tune ofthe donation.
